Triennial 2026 News
The Triennial is almost here and we can't wait to enjoy the fellowship of our companions from around the world. Just a few things for you to know before you begin your "rough and rugged road" to Washington, D.C.
Dress code - Please be advised that some of this has changed over time. The following is a recommendation for your consideration.
Saturday and Sunday - casual wear for most activities. You may want to a coat and tie for the Sunday Opening ceremony and memorial service.
Monday - General Grand Chapter meeting: Red coat, tie, dark pants, [OR dark suit] and any regalia you would normally wear to a Chapter meeting
General Grand Chapter Banquet: Formal for men and ladies or dark suit/"Sunday best"
Tuesday - General Grand Council meeting: Purple coat, tie, dark pants, [OR dark suit] and any regalia you would normally wear to a Council meeting
General Grand Council Banquet: Dark suit for the men and "Sunday best" for the ladies
Registration -
Everyone must go to the registration desk, on the second floor, and get your meal tickets and convention bag. If you are a voting delegate you must go to the Credentials desk to get your ballot. If you registered as a delegate, everything should be in order. If you are a late obtaining proxy or just forgot you are a dias officer!!!, you still must go to the Credentials desk to get your ballot - it just might take a little longer. Both Registration and Credentials are on the second floor. BE ADVISED: When the gavel sounds to open, it is too late to register.
Welcome reception - This is a new addition. The General Grand Chapter and General Grand Council will host a Welcome Reception on Sunday night from 5:30 pm to 7:30 pm. There will be light refreshments served. It is a "drop in" function. Come by and visit with your Companions from around the world. Come by and make new friends you otherwise would never know. It will be a great fellowship event. REMEMBER, IT IS A RECEPTION -- NOT DINNER!!! Enjoy your Triennial and leave some refreshments for your other Companions.
